Output ee8385b900fba838c19af7ca79c72b5220b52715db1777a89c27525ebd03b900:0

value
530070
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b868ad22c90315feabc426bc353217ce7952b10d OP_EQUAL
address
3JW5esta6YML5rNsgCqrAhswquA2EDs4Yq
transaction
ee8385b900fba838c19af7ca79c72b5220b52715db1777a89c27525ebd03b900
spent
true